#b35693 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b35693 is composed of 70.2% red, 33.7%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52% magenta, 17.9%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 320.6 degrees, a saturation of 38% and a lightness of 52%. #b35693 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ffacff with #670027.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#b35693 color description : Moderate pink.
#b35693 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b35693 has RGB values of R:179, G:86,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.18,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11753107.
